Former Indiana Governor and South Bend Mayor Joe Kernan was awarded one of Notre Dame's top honors.
Kernan was presented with the 2018 Rev. Edward Frederick Sorin, C.S.C., Award by the Notre Dame Alumni Association.
The award, which bears the university founder's name is given to notable alumni who go above and beyond in their service and contributions to the community and country.
Previous winners include Father Theodore Hesburgh and Regis Philbin.
